For those who are new to the world of torrenting, a torrent is a type of file that allows users to download large files, such as movies and TV shows, from the internet. Torrents work by breaking down the file into smaller pieces, which are then shared among users who are downloading and uploading the file simultaneously. This decentralized approach to file sharing allows for faster download speeds and more efficient use of bandwidth.
Torrenting copyrighted material without permission is illegal in most countries. Internet Service Providers (ISPs) actively monitor peer-to-peer (P2P) networks for copyrighted tracking hashes. If you are caught downloading Seinfeld , your ISP can throttle your internet speeds, suspend your service, or forward your information to copyright enforcement agencies, leading to hefty fines. 4.
